In this paper we evaluate a recently proposed multiple-input multiple-output (MIMO) system called the Layered Steered Space-Time Codes (LSSTC). The LSSTC system is evaluated for multi-user environments where scheduling can be used to increase the system capacity by harnessing the multi-user diversity. In this paper, we introduce an orthogonalization aided distributed scheduling algorithm for multiuser MIMO broadcast channels (MU-MIMO BC). In this algorithm each mobile station (MS) selects transmission scheme, including beamforming (BF) and spatial multiplexing (SM) according to its channel state and feeds back channel state information (CSI) adaptively.
